A-Format™ is the raw, four-channel output captured by the microphone's individual capsules. This format is essential because it allows you to manipulate the sound field in post-production, giving you the flexibility to convert the recording into various surround sound or spatial audio formats later.
Yes, you will need to use the included RØDE SoundField processing plug-in to convert your A-Format recordings into B-Format or other surround sound standards. The plug-in is designed to seamlessly integrate with most major digital audio workstations.
While the NT-SF1 is specifically engineered for 360° immersive audio, you can certainly use it for stereo applications. By using the processing software, you can manipulate the virtual microphone patterns to create a stereo image, though it is primarily intended for more complex spatial projects.
The NT-SF1 requires 48V phantom power to operate. Because it features four individual capsules, you must ensure your audio interface or recorder can provide stable 48V phantom power across all four input channels simultaneously.
Yes, it is well-suited for field work, especially since the kit includes a blimp-style windshield and a furry wind cover to manage wind noise. However, because it is a sensitive condenser microphone, you should handle it with care in extreme weather conditions.
The microphone uses a multi-pin output that connects to the included breakout cable, which splits the signal into four standard XLR connectors. You will need an audio interface or field recorder with at least four high-quality XLR inputs to capture the full ambisonic signal.
